WAL-MART plans 40 more stores in India

Wal-Mart plans to open 40 more stores in India, Indian Commerce and Industry Minister Anand Sharma said. "Wal-Mart is very satisfied with its results in India. I was informed by the Wal-Mart CEO that they are looking at opening more stores.

He gave me a figure of 40 more stores across the country in the immediate future, Sharma said at the India Economic Summit. The retailer has a cash & carry joint venture with Bharti Grop and runs the Best Price Modert stores. The retailer opened its first cash & carry store in May this year.
